If we revisit the example of a $1,300 gross savings from a load of 540 BF of white oak lumber, and we subtract the estimated cost of $62 to kiln dry the lumber, we arrive at a net savings of $1,238 less than retail. Moisture content step schedules can be converted to schedules based on time once a kiln operator develops a data record from at least 6 different kiln runs with lumber of the same thickness and species. This can be done by heating above 133F for 4 hours (measured at the core of the wood), or at 120F for about 7 - 10 days. The MC ranges are chosen so that the loss of the first one-third of moisture, and the highest risk of checking and staining, will occur in the first step listed.).
